Present Status, Limitations and Future Directions of Treatment Strategies Using Fucoidan-Based Therapies in Bladder
Yasuyoshi Miyata1, Tomohiro Matsuo1, Kojiro Ohba1
1Department of Urology, Graduate School of Biomedical Sciences, Nagasaki University, Nagasaki 852-8501, Japan.
Fucoidan, a marine algae extract, shows anti-cancer effects and may mitigate side effects for bladder cancer (BC) patients. Further research is needed to confirm its clinical usefulness in BC treatment.

Background:
- Bladder cancer (BC) presents a poor prognosis in advanced stages, with current treatments causing significant adverse events.
- Natural product-based therapies are being explored as alternatives or adjuncts for BC management.
- Fucoidan, derived from marine brown algae, exhibits anti-cancer properties and protective effects against treatment toxicities.
Purpose of the Study:
- To review the anti-cancer effects and molecular mechanisms of fucoidan extracts in bladder cancer.
- To explore the synergistic effects of fucoidan with conventional chemotherapy and novel nanoparticle-based strategies.
- To highlight fucoidan's potential in mitigating cancer-related disorders and chemotherapy-induced adverse events.
Main Methods:
- Literature review of in vivo and in vitro studies on fucoidan's efficacy in various malignancies, including bladder cancer.
- Analysis of molecular mechanisms underlying fucoidan's anti-cancer and protective effects.
- Examination of studies involving fucoidan in combination therapies and nanoparticle formulations.
Main Results:
- Fucoidan demonstrates anti-cancer activity and potential protective effects against cancer-related cachexia and chemotherapy-induced toxicity.
- Studies suggest fucoidan enhances the efficacy of conventional chemotherapeutic agents and shows promise in nanoparticle-based treatments.
- Evidence indicates fucoidan's benefits extend to mitigating cisplatin-induced toxicities.
Conclusions:
- Fucoidan exhibits promising anti-cancer and supportive effects relevant to bladder cancer treatment.
- While promising, current data is insufficient to establish the clinical utility of fucoidan-based therapies for bladder cancer.
- Further research and clinical trials are necessary to determine the optimal application and efficacy of fucoidan in bladder cancer management.
